High Country trim tops out 2014 Chevrolet Silverado lineup

Mon, 06 May 2013

The Chevrolet Silverado lineup has expanded for 2014, adding a High Country trim that tops out the pickup's lineup with a chrome exterior and premium engine option. Pricing hasn't been released, but the current Chevy Silverado tops out with the Z71 and LTZ trim, which can carry prices in the mid-$40,000 range. The High Country Silverado will be slotted above those trims, but below the 2014 GMC Sierra Denali, the top-of-the-line offering from Chevy's sister brand.

Infiniti G37 Convertible (2008): more photos

Mon, 06 Oct 2008

By Tim Pollard First Official Pictures 06 October 2008 12:14 Infiniti has released another photograph of its new G37 Convertible – the roadster version of Nissan’s new 3-series fighter. The car will be formally shown at the 2008 Los Angeles motor show and this is only the second photograph of the new cabrio that goes on sale next summer. It’s the convertible version of the G37 Coupe (read our first drive here) and, like its 3-series target, uses a folding hard-top roof.
